/*----------------------------------------------------------------------
| AP4_MovieFragment::AP4_MovieFragment
+---------------------------------------------------------------------*/
AP4_MovieFragment::AP4_MovieFragment(AP4_ContainerAtom* moof) :
m_MoofAtom(moof),
m_MfhdAtom(NULL)
{
if (moof) m_MfhdAtom = AP4_DYNAMIC_CAST(AP4_MfhdAtom, moof->GetChild(AP4_ATOM_TYPE_MFHD));
}
/*----------------------------------------------------------------------
| AP4_MovieFragment::~AP4_MovieFragment
+---------------------------------------------------------------------*/
AP4_MovieFragment::~AP4_MovieFragment()
{
delete m_MoofAtom;
}
/*----------------------------------------------------------------------
| AP4_MovieFragment::GetSequenceNumber
+---------------------------------------------------------------------*/
AP4_UI32
AP4_MovieFragment::GetSequenceNumber()
{
return m_MfhdAtom?m_MfhdAtom->GetSequenceNumber():0;
}
/*----------------------------------------------------------------------
| AP4_MovieFragment::GetTrackIds
+---------------------------------------------------------------------*/
AP4_Result
AP4_MovieFragment::GetTrackIds(AP4_Array<AP4_UI32>& ids)
{
ids.Clear();
ids.EnsureCapacity(m_MoofAtom->GetChildren().ItemCount());
for (AP4_List<AP4_Atom>::Item* item = m_MoofAtom->GetChildren().FirstItem();
item;
item = item->GetNext()) {
AP4_Atom* atom = item->GetData();
if (atom->GetType() == AP4_ATOM_TYPE_TRAF) {
AP4_ContainerAtom* traf = AP4_DYNAMIC_CAST(AP4_ContainerAtom, atom);
if (traf) {
AP4_TfhdAtom* tfhd = AP4_DYNAMIC_CAST(AP4_TfhdAtom, traf->GetChild(AP4_ATOM_TYPE_TFHD));
if (tfhd) ids.Append(tfhd->GetTrackId());
}
}
}
return AP4_SUCCESS;
}
/*----------------------------------------------------------------------
| AP4_MovieFragment::GetTrafAtom
+---------------------------------------------------------------------*/
AP4_Result
AP4_MovieFragment::GetTrafAtom(AP4_UI32 track_id, AP4_ContainerAtom*& traf)
{
for (AP4_List<AP4_Atom>::Item* item = m_MoofAtom->GetChildren().FirstItem();
item;
item = item->GetNext()) {
AP4_Atom* atom = item->GetData();
if (atom->GetType() == AP4_ATOM_TYPE_TRAF) {
traf = AP4_DYNAMIC_CAST(AP4_ContainerAtom, atom);
if (traf) {
AP4_TfhdAtom* tfhd = AP4_DYNAMIC_CAST(AP4_TfhdAtom, traf->GetChild(AP4_ATOM_TYPE_TFHD));
if (tfhd && tfhd->GetTrackId() == track_id) {
return AP4_SUCCESS;
}
}
}
}
// not found
traf = NULL;
return AP4_ERROR_NO_SUCH_ITEM;
}
/*----------------------------------------------------------------------
| AP4_MovieFragment::CreateSampleTable
+---------------------------------------------------------------------*/
AP4_Result
AP4_MovieFragment::CreateSampleTable(AP4_MoovAtom* moov,
AP4_UI32 track_id,
AP4_ByteStream* sample_stream,
AP4_Position moof_offset,
AP4_Position mdat_payload_offset,
AP4_UI64 dts_origin,
AP4_FragmentSampleTable*& sample_table)
{
// default value
sample_table = NULL;
// find a trex for this track, if any
AP4_ContainerAtom* mvex = NULL;
AP4_TrexAtom* trex = NULL;
if (moov) {
mvex = AP4_DYNAMIC_CAST(AP4_ContainerAtom, moov->GetChild(AP4_ATOM_TYPE_MVEX));
}
if (mvex) {
for (AP4_List<AP4_Atom>::Item* item = mvex->GetChildren().FirstItem();
item;
item = item->GetNext()) {
AP4_Atom* atom = item->GetData();
if (atom->GetType() == AP4_ATOM_TYPE_TREX) {
trex = AP4_DYNAMIC_CAST(AP4_TrexAtom, atom);
if (trex && trex->GetTrackId() == track_id) break;
trex = NULL;
}
}
}
AP4_ContainerAtom* traf = NULL;
if (AP4_SUCCEEDED(GetTrafAtom(track_id, traf))) {
sample_table = new AP4_FragmentSampleTable(traf,
trex,
sample_stream,
moof_offset,
mdat_payload_offset,
dts_origin);
return AP4_SUCCESS;
}
return AP4_ERROR_NO_SUCH_ITEM;
}
/*----------------------------------------------------------------------
| AP4_MovieFragment::CreateSampleTable
+---------------------------------------------------------------------*/
AP4_Result
AP4_MovieFragment::CreateSampleTable(AP4_Movie* movie,
AP4_UI32 track_id,
AP4_ByteStream* sample_stream,
AP4_Position moof_offset,
AP4_Position mdat_payload_offset,
AP4_UI64 dts_origin,
AP4_FragmentSampleTable*& sample_table)
{
AP4_MoovAtom* moov = movie?movie->GetMoovAtom():NULL;
return CreateSampleTable(moov, track_id, sample_stream, moof_offset, mdat_payload_offset, dts_origin, sample_table);
}
